Patient Care Representative applicants have rated the interview process at CITYMD with 2.4 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 88% positive. To compare, the company-average is 71.2%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Patient Care Representative roles take an average of 14 days to get hired, when considering 25 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at CITYMD overall takes an average of 15 days.
Common stages of the interview process at CITYMD as a Patient Care Representative according to 25 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 41%
Phone interview: 31%
Background check: 10%
Presentation: 5%
Personality test: 5%
Drug test: 5%
Skills test: 3%
